Subject: Cool toy at my gym

I belong to LA Fitness.  I just swam at a new location yesterday, when I got out of the water on the way to the locker room I saw this thing hanging on the wall.    It’s a machine where you put your swim suit in this basket and hold down the top for about 10 seconds and the basket spins really fast, like the spin cycle on the washer and it extracts all the water from your suit.  It was pretty cool, anyone else seen/used one of these contraptions?
